Factors to Consider When Choosing Vehicle Battery Jump Starters
Choosing the right vehicle battery jump starter involves more than just looking at the highest amp rating. Consider your vehicle’s engine size, as larger engines require more power to start. Portability and size matter if you plan to keep the jump starter in your trunk or garage. Additional features like USB charging ports and LED lights can add convenience but may increase cost. Safety features such as spark-proof clamps and reverse polarity protection are critical for avoiding accidents. Finally, assess the build quality and warranty to ensure long-term reliability, especially if you rely heavily on the device.Power and Peak Amperage
Peak amperage directly impacts a jump starter’s ability to start larger engines. For most cars, 1000-1500A is sufficient, but trucks or SUVs with bigger engines benefit from units offering 2000A or more. Overestimating power can be a waste if your vehicle is smaller, but underestimating risks leaving you stranded. Consider your vehicle’s engine size carefully and match it with a jump starter that provides enough power without excess bulk.
Portability and Size
Portability matters if you want a device that’s easy to store and carry. Lithium-ion models tend to be lighter and more compact than traditional lead-acid options, making them ideal for frequent use or emergency kits. However, smaller units may have lower peak amps, limiting their use to smaller vehicles. Balance size with power; a compact model might be more convenient but ensure it still meets your vehicle’s starting requirements.
Additional Features
Features like USB ports, LED flashlights, and LCD displays add convenience, especially during roadside emergencies. USB ports allow charging phones or devices, while LED lights provide illumination at night. However, these extras often increase the price and can sometimes complicate the device’s design. Decide which features are essential based on your typical use case—if you often drive at night or in remote areas, these extras can be worthwhile.
Safety and Reliability
Safety features such as spark-proof clamps, reverse polarity protection, and overload prevention are vital. A jump starter with solid safety measures minimizes the risk of sparks or damage to your vehicle’s electrical system. Build quality also influences longevity—cheaper models might fail sooner or lack sufficient insulation. Investing in a well-made unit with safety certifications can save you from roadside hazards and costly repairs.
Price and Warranty
Prices vary from budget-friendly options to premium models with advanced features. Cheaper units may lack durability or safety features, making them less reliable over time. Conversely, higher-priced models often include longer warranties, better build quality, and more power. Consider your frequency of use and whether the added expense aligns with your needs—if you only need occasional use, a mid-range model might suffice. For regular drivers, investing in a premium unit could be more cost-effective in the long run.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use a jump starter on a diesel engine?
Yes, many high-capacity jump starters are capable of starting diesel engines, which typically require more power. Look for models rated for at least 4000A peak for diesel trucks or large SUVs. Always check the manufacturer’s specifications for compatibility with diesel engines, and ensure the jump starter’s current output matches or exceeds your vehicle’s starting requirements for safe use.
How long does a jump starter’s battery last before it needs recharging?
The battery life depends on the specific model and how often it’s used. Most lithium-ion jump starters can hold a charge for several months if stored properly and recharged periodically, typically every 3-6 months. Regular maintenance ensures readiness for emergencies and avoids the frustration of a dead device when needed most. Keep an eye on the LCD indicator or LED lights to monitor the charge level regularly.
Are portable jump starters safe for my vehicle’s electronic systems?
Yes, most modern jump starters include safety features like spark-proof clamps and reverse polarity protection, which safeguard your vehicle’s electronics. However, it’s essential to follow the manufacturer’s instructions carefully to prevent accidental damage. Using a device with certified safety features significantly reduces the risk of electrical issues during the jump-start process.
What is the best way to store my jump starter?
Store your jump starter in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ight and extreme temperatures. Keep it in your vehicle’s trunk or garage where it’s easily accessible. Regularly check the charge level and recharge it as recommended—most units need to be topped off every few months. Proper storage extends the device’s lifespan and ensures it’s ready when needed.
Should I buy a jump starter with an air compressor?
A jump starter with an air compressor offers added convenience for inflating tires and other inflatables, making it a versatile tool for emergencies. However, these units tend to be larger and more expensive. If you frequently encounter flat tires or want a multi-purpose device, it can be a good investment. Otherwise, a dedicated jump starter without an air compressor might be more compact and cost-effective for just starting your vehicle.
